The tiny island nation of Haiti, home to some of the world's strongest, passionate and creative people, has a rich culture, remarkable past and delectable cuisine. 

It will be hard to meet a person who has eaten our food who has not fallen in love with its flavor, spice, richness and variety.

 So, we want to introduce our unique cuisine to Raleigh. 

It has been in demand among the city's growing Haitian community and Caribbean community at-large for several years. The time is now.

Phase 1 of our fundraising campaign will be to roll out a Haitian cuisine dinner delivery service. Dubbed the "Haitian Kitchen," the idea behind this venture is to deliver to homes of subscribers a variety of prepared Haitian meals. Each meal will either be ready-to-eat, oven, stove-top or microwave ready. 

Unlike big-wigs Blue Apron and Hello Fresh, we take the prepwork out of the equation and you simply enjoy a savory and satisfying meal.

Our goal is to open our doors the end of 2017.  Help us accomplish that.
